Output 768aa33b6b99ddf5e31f8ddac6355138f885b8b04a00aa95a61c14d6825acae4:7

value
318880
script pubkey
OP_0 OP_PUSHBYTES_20 39bfa90f905e2f615247eeb7338f181406000576
address
bc1q8xl6jrustchkz5j8a6mn8rcczsrqqptkpl3eul
transaction
768aa33b6b99ddf5e31f8ddac6355138f885b8b04a00aa95a61c14d6825acae4